How do I take screenshots?

Here's how to take a screenshot:


On Android devices:


  • Press the volume down button and the power button at the same time.

  • The screen should flash, and you’ll see a notification that a screenshot has been captured.

  • You can find the screenshot in your device’s Gallery or Photos app.


On iPhone/iPad:


  • On devices with Face ID, press and release the side button and volume up button at the same time.

  • On devices with a Home button, press the Home button and the side button (or Sleep/Wake button) together.

  • Screenshots are saved in the Photos app under Screenshots.


On Windows:


  • Press the PrtScn (Print Screen) key to capture the entire screen. The image is copied to your clipboard, and you can paste it into an app like Paint or a document.

  • To capture only the active window, press Alt + PrtScn.

  • To capture a specific area or take a delayed screenshot, use Windows + Shift + S to open the Snipping Tool.


On Mac:


  • Press Command (⌘) + Shift + 3 to capture the entire screen.

  • Press Command (⌘) + Shift + 4 to capture a selected portion of the screen.

  • Press Command (⌘) + Shift + 5 to open the screenshot toolbar, which allows you to record the screen or take different kinds of screenshots.

  • By default, screenshots are saved to your Desktop.
